Structural VAR Models

Structural Vector Autoregressive (SVAR) models are statistical tools used to analyze relationships among multiple variables over time. They help identify how shocks or changes in one variable, like interest rates or inflation, influence others, while accounting for the interconnected nature of economic factors. By imposing restrictions based on economic theory, SVAR models distinguish between correlation and causation, providing clearer insights into the underlying mechanisms driving observed data. This allows economists to better understand the dynamics of complex systems, forecast future developments, and evaluate policy impacts with greater clarity.
